Rhovanion should rely on nature :cool:

I was thinking about this on the train ride into school (lol, good old long commute, what would I do without you?). I've come up with the idea of enhancing the usefulness of Galadriel's Handmaidens and turning them into a semi-siege unit. I'd give them a special ability that calls vines out of the ground and do damage to buildings/walls/gates (ability name being "Prayer to Yavanna"). The vines wouldn't be nearly as powerful as Bruinen, Throw Down its Walls, or Light of the Noldor, but having multiple handmaidens would solve that deficiency. Furthermore, you would be able to combine a handmaiden with a battalion of infantry units so they could defend her, and she'd of course have her healing radius.

How does that sound to you guys?
